Year: 1998
Runtime: 103 mins
Language: Chinese
It follows two Chinese immigrants navigating life in Los Angeles. Yuan Liu, who has spent years living in a wagon with no steady job or family, appears resigned but content. His routine is upended when he meets Qing Li, an ambitious newcomer chasing the classic American dream, prompting both to confront their hopes and hardships.

When Liu Yuan meets Li Qing while scouting a mansion for a Beijing film crew, he insists she lacks the skills to survive in American city life. Rather than see her struggle, he decides to send her back to Beijing by purchasing an air ticket. This act appears generous on the surface, but it also reveals Liu's own uncertainty about building a stable relationship, he chooses to remove her from his chaotic world rather than risk letting her stay and face hardships with him.
Despite Liu buying her a ticket to return to Beijing, Li Qing never actually uses it. Instead, she remains in Los Angeles, renting a cheap apartment and working as a cleaner. Her decision reflects a deeper determination to make it in America, she wants to prove to herself that she can survive and succeed on her own terms, not be sent away by someone else's judgment.
The narrative presents their repeated encounters as a series of coincidences that feel almost fate-driven, they keep appearing in the same places despite no intentional effort to meet. After their initial meeting at the mansion, they reunite a year later in LA, then get caught up in the same criminal investigation, and later find each other again through a newspaper ad. The movie frames this pattern as their "jinxed" connection, suggesting the universe keeps pulling them together despite their attempts to separate.
After Liu and Li are arrested for their involvement with the travel agency that turns out to be a human smuggling ring, Li Qing becomes deeply unsettled by the chaos that follows Liu. The ordeal, the hold-up, the police, the criminal investigation, convinces her that being with Liu brings too much trouble and instability. She decides to cut contact completely and rebuild her life separately, vowing never to meet him again.
A year after their breakup, Liu places a classified ad in a local Chinese-language newspaper specifically looking for Li Qing. At that point, Li has opened her own florist shop and is teaching Mandarin part-time to Chinese Americans. The ad catches her attention, and she responds, giving them another chance to reconnect. This method shows Liu's willingness to actively pursue the relationship rather than simply letting fate decide.
When Liu learns his mother has suffered a serious cerebral hemorrhage in Beijing, he returns home to fulfill his filial duties. He deliberately chooses not to pressure Li Qing to accompany him because he knows she has just obtained her green card after years of hard work in the U.S. He doesn't want to ask her to give up the stability she has built, so he leaves solo, respecting her sacrifices even though it means separation.
Li Qing decides to board the flight to Beijing despite having just received her green card, showing she values Liu enough to follow him home. Her presence on the plane indicates her commitment, she chooses love over the security of her newly-established American life. She appears next to Liu mid-flight, surprising him after his worried dream about them not meeting for decades.
Earlier, Liu dreamed they wouldn't see each other until an old folks' home decades later, making her sudden appearance a hopeful twist.
When the plane experiences a technical malfunction that seems to be heading toward a crash, the near-death experience forces both characters to confront their true feelings. In the face of imminent death, they profess their love for each other. The crisis strips away their hesitation and fear of commitment, allowing them to finally be honest about their feelings after years of on-again, off-again uncertainty.
During their flight from Los Angeles to Beijing, the plane encounters a technical malfunction that makes it seem heading for a disaster. This is presented as another mishap in their long line of "hexed" encounters. However, the technical problem is resolved just moments after Liu and Li confess their love, turning what could have been a tragedy into a moment that cements their relationship.
After the plane lands and they decide to get married, Li discovers during their first kiss that Liu is wearing dentures. This humorous reveal adds a lighthearted twist to their happy ending, showing that even in their most intimate moment, their relationship is marked by the unexpected and the slightly absurd, fitting the movie's comedic tone.
